Aldi is recalling 300g Skellig Bay Mackerel Fillets from its shelves, the company has said on its website. The product code on the item is 68124 and the batch affected has a use by date of 30/06/17. Skellig Bay Mackerel Fillets are being recalled because high levels of histamine in the product have been detected. The batch affected is past the 'Use By' date but customers may have frozen this product. If you have this product at home, customers have been told that they can return it to their nearest Aldi store where a full refund will be issued.
